11.1 and 11.2 Fluids moving across surfaces—qualitative analysis and Flow rate and fluid speed

Blood flow in capillaries The flow rate of blood in the aorta is 80 cm3/s. Beyond the aorta, this blood eventually travels through about 6 X 109 capillaries, each of radius 8.0 X 10-4 cm. What is the speed of the blood in the capillaries?
